Stamp value on possession letter

(Querist) 28 February 2015 This query is : Resolved 
Respected Sir,

Please tell me on what value of stamp paper possession letter should be taken from seller of if the value of flat is 236000/- and purchased in vasai(Maharastra).

Devajyoti Barman (Expert) 28 February 2015
Possession letter need not be written on a stamp paper.
Dr J C Vashista (Expert) 01 March 2015
@Usman,
1. Did you get the Sale Deed registered?
2. If yes, there is a covenant in the sale deed where the vendor (seller) has delivered peaceful vacant possession of the property (under sale) to the vendee (purchaser). Accordingly there is no need/legal requirement for a separate "possession letter" consequently no stamp duty to be paid.
3. However, even if the "possession letter" is felt necessary/required or desired no separate stamp paper is required to execute "possession letter", it would be written, signed, witnessed and attested on a plan paper.
